Roll Out
• The Government ambition is to have the best Superfast
Broadband Network in Europe by 2016.
• By 2014 two thirds of UK premises (residential and business)
will have access to superfast broadband
• Improved broadband (above 2Mbps) to every home and
business in the project area for Gloucestershire by end
2015
• Faster broadband (30Mbps or more) to around 90% of
homes and businesses in Gloucestershire by end 2015
• To find out about the roll out of faster broadband in your
area visit www.fastershire.com
What is Superfast Business?
• Superfast Business is a European Funded programme of fully
funded business support for SMEs
• Free Events, Free 1 to 1 Advisor Meeting, Free Specialist
Workshop , Free Time Stamped Market Ready Support Plan.
• Delivered by:
o Business West in Gloucestershire, South Gloucestershire, BANES & Wiltshire
o Peninsula Enterprise in Devon and Somerset
o Wessex Enterprise in Dorset
• Business advice and specialist support to help growth businesses maximise the
opportunities of Superfast Broadband and associated technologies.
• Benefits for businesses can include:
Competitive advantage
Increased productivity
Access to new markets
Remote working
Opportunity for innovation
Efficiency and timesaving
• Eligibility criteria apply to businesses accessing the service

5 – Build your presence
Build your presence
• Develop your profiles – Business and/or Personal
• Include photograph to build engagement
• Keep it brief
• Talk about benefits not features
Build your presence
• Speak to people – not AT them
• Always reply to direct comments and questions
• Engage in conversations
• 80% - be friendly, re-tweet / Comment / Engage
• 20% - Add new content
• Join groups and participate
Be active
6 – Maintain your profile
Maintain your profile
• Check your accounts daily
• Thank re-Tweets
• Thank new followers/Likes/Connections
• Respond to comments
• Reply to questions
• Find new Likes/Followers/Connections
• Find authoritative people and Follow/Like their followers
• Connect with people in Groups [Facebook/Linkedin]
• Search for branded terms to see who is talking about
what
Maintain your profile
Invest
30 Minutes
per day
Maintain your profile
